导图社区 什么是瘦客户端
这是一个关于什么是瘦客户端的思维导图,讲述了什么是瘦客户端的相关故事,如果你对什么是瘦客户端的故事感兴趣,欢迎对该思维导图收藏和点赞~
编辑于2021-10-22 15:40:28什么是瘦客户端
瘦客户端的定义
瘦客户端是一种轻量级的应用程序,通常用于网络应用程序。
瘦客户端的主要目的是减少客户端的计算负担,提高响应速度和用户体验。
瘦客户端的特点
低带宽占用
瘦客户端通常只需要传输必要的数据,从而降低网络带宽占用。
高度依赖服务器
瘦客户端的大部分处理逻辑都在服务器端实现,客户端只需要处理用户交互和显示。
易于维护和升级
由于大部分逻辑都在服务器端,因此瘦客户端的维护和升级相对简单。
瘦客户端与胖客户端的区别
胖客户端是指功能丰富、处理能力强的客户端应用程序。
瘦客户端与胖客户端的主要区别在于处理逻辑的分布和服务器端的依赖程度。
瘦客户端的应用场景
网页应用
网页应用通常使用瘦客户端模式,将处理逻辑放在服务器端,客户端只需要处理用户交互和显示。
移动应用
移动应用通常也需要使用瘦客户端模式,以降低设备资源占用和提升用户体验。
物联网应用
物联网设备通常需要低功耗、低资源占用的应用程序,因此瘦客户端模式非常适合物联网应用。
瘦客户端的优点
降低客户端资源占用
瘦客户端可以将大部分处理逻辑放在服务器端,从而降低客户端的资源占用。
提高响应速度
由于大部分处理逻辑都在服务器端,因此瘦客户端的响应速度通常比胖客户端更快。
易于维护和升级
由于大部分逻辑都在服务器端,因此瘦客户端的维护和升级相对简单。
跨平台兼容性
瘦客户端通常使用网页技术开发,因此具有良好的跨平台兼容性。
瘦客户端的缺点
依赖网络连接
瘦客户端需要与服务器保持连接,因此在网络不稳定的情况下,用户体验可能会受到影响。
数据安全风险
由于大部分数据都在服务器端,因此瘦客户端可能面临数据安全风险。
初始加载时间较长
由于瘦客户端需要从服务器端加载必要的数据,因此初始加载时间可能较长。
不适用于离线场景
瘦客户端需要与服务器保持连接,因此不适用于离线场景。